Responsibilities
- Develop, maintain, and troubleshoot PC-based control software using C# (.NET) for custom automation equipment.
- Integrate and commission automation systems including PLCs, motion controllers, servo drives, and PC-based control platforms.
- Modify, test, and debug PLC programs for platforms such as Siemens, Allen-Bradley, and Omron as part of overall system integration.
- Configure and tune motion control systems, including servo drives, axes, and motion profiles, to meet performance and reliability requirements.
- Support machine bring-up activities, including initial power-up, debugging, and optimization of new automation equipment.
- Lead commissioning efforts and support production ramp-up activities to ensure stable and efficient operation of automated systems.
- Perform system validation, including I/O checks, functional testing, and failure mode or negative scenario testing to verify system robustness.
- Deploy software builds to machines using proper version control, backup, and rollback procedures to maintain software integrity.
- Troubleshoot and resolve issues across software, electrical, and motion control components, working systematically to identify root causes.
- Integrate and calibrate sensors, vision systems, and industrial transducers to ensure accurate and reliable data acquisition.
- Support the development and maintenance of HMI functionality, including multilingual or dual-language interfaces for operators.
- Collaborate closely with mechanical, electrical, and manufacturing teams during system integration to ensure cohesive system performance.
- Document commissioning activities, test results, configuration changes, and maintain detailed software version history for traceability.
- Participate in onsite training and knowledge transfer activities at the equipment development location to prepare for installation and start-up in the United States.
- Serve as the primary controls engineer during installation and start-up of the equipment in the U.S., applying knowledge gained during the training period.
Essential Skills
- Experience with PC-based automation programming in C# (.NET).
- Proficiency in C# programming for industrial control and automation applications.
- Hands-on experience commissioning and supporting industrial automation equipment.
- Experience with PLC programming, including development, modification, testing, and debugging.
- Ability to work with PLC platforms such as Siemens, Allen-Bradley, and Omron.
- Experience with motion control systems, including configuring and tuning servo drives, axes, and motion profiles.
- Strong skills in troubleshooting and resolving issues across software, electrical, and motion control components.
- Experience with PC-based automation systems and integrated machine hardware.
- Ability to perform system validation, including I/O checks, functional testing, and failure mode or negative scenario testing.
- Familiarity with integrating and commissioning automation systems that include PLCs, motion controllers, servo drives, and PC-based platforms.
Additional Skills & Qualifications
- Experience integrating and calibrating sensors, vision systems, and industrial transducers.
- Experience supporting HMI functionality, including multilingual or dual-language interfaces.
- Background working in automation, robotics, and high-volume electronic device assembly environments.
- Experience collaborating with mechanical, electrical, and manufacturing teams during system integration.
- Comfort working in fast-paced project environments that include international travel and extended onsite support.
- Interest in working on advanced automation equipment and robotics used in the production of consumer electronic devices.
The role begins with an intensive four-week assignment in Hosur, India, in an engineering and manufacturing environment where the Controls Engineer will train and learn the technology used in the automation equipment. During this period, the schedule is six days per week with 10-hour workdays, providing significant overtime opportunities. Following the training phase, the position transitions to a facility in Houston, Texas, for approximately 20 weeks, where the engineer will support installation, start-up, and production activities as part of a major U.S. production initiative. The work environment includes advanced automation equipment, robotics, PC-based control systems, PLCs, motion control hardware, sensors, and vision systems. The role is hands-on and primarily onsite at engineering and manufacturing facilities, working closely with multidisciplinary teams to bring complex automation systems into full production.
Job Type & LocationThis is a Contract to Hire position based out of Whitmore Lake, MI.
Pay and Benefits The pay range for this position is $45.00 - $50.00/hr.Eligibility requirements apply to some benefits and may depend on your job classification and length of employment. Benefits are subject to change and may be subject to specific elections, plan, or program terms. If eligible, the benefits available for this temporary role may include the following:
Medical, dental & vision
Critical Illness, Accident, and Hospital
401(k) Retirement Plan Pre-tax and Roth post-tax contributions available
Life Insurance (Voluntary Life & AD&D for the employee and dependents)
Short and long-term disability
Health Spending Account (HSA)
Transportation benefits
Employee Assistance Program
Time Off/Leave (PTO, Vacation or Sick Leave)
This is a fully onsite position in Whitmore Lake,MI.
Application Deadline This position is anticipated to close on Jun 16, 2026.About Actalent
Actalent is a global leader in engineering and sciences services and talent solutions.We help visionary companies advance their engineering and science initiatives throughaccess to specialized experts who drive scale, innovation and speed to market.With a network of almost 30,000 consultants and more than 4,500 clients across the U.S.,Canada, Asia and Europe, Actalent serves many of the Fortune 500.
The company is an equal opportunity employer and will consider all applications withoutregard to race, sex, age, color, religion, national origin, veteran status, disability,sexual orientation, gender identity, genetic information or any characteristic protectedby law.
If you would like to request a reasonable accommodation, such as the modification oradjustment of the job application process or interviewing process due to a disability,please email ... for other accommodation options.
San Francisco Fair Chance Ordinance: Pursuant to the San Francisco Fair Chance Ordinance, for all positions located in thecity and county of San Francisco, we will consider for employment qualified applicantswith arrest and conviction records.
Massachusetts Lie Detector: It is unlawful in Massachusetts to require or administer a lie detector test as acondition of employment or continued employment. An employer who violates this lawshall be subject to criminal penalties and civil liability.
Use of Artificial Intelligence (AI): We may use Artificial Intelligence (AI) to support parts of our hiring process,including sourcing, screening, and evaluating candidates. AI helps assess applicationsand qualifications, but final decisions are made by our hiring team. By applying, youacknowledge and agree that your application may be reviewed using AI tools.